CAMDEN – A memorial service for Sandra R. Currie, 70, will be held Sunday at 6:30 p.m. at Cedar Creek Baptist Church. The Rev. Bobby James will officiate. In lieu of flowers, memorials may be made to the family to assist with final expenses by way of cashapp to $chadcurrie72.


Sandra passed away on Tuesday, January 7, 2025. Born in Harris County, Ga, she was a daughter of the late Dalton Ray and Merle Barontine Henderson. Sandra enjoyed arts and crafts, painting, and shopping, especially on Temu.


Surviving are her husband, Donald “Donnie” Hall; children, Chad Currie (Tracey) of Camden, Chris Currie of Camden, Jennifer Ham (Dale) of Camden; step-children, Donnie Hall of Columbia, April Fludd (Craig) of Columbia, Wayne Hall (Courtney) of Hartsville; a sister, Shirley Castleberry of Flowery Branch, GA; and 15 grandchildren. She was predeceased by sisters, Virginia Todd, Rudene Currie, Charlotte Ray; and 1 grandchild.
